Summary
Most technical screens test whether a candidate can Google fast under pressure — not whether they can actually work with AI the way your engineering team does every day. Swiftcruit is built around that gap.
The platform takes a job description, generates role-specific coding challenges, multiple-choice questions, and descriptive problems with rubrics, then lets candidates solve them inside an AI-enabled environment. The differentiating bet: instead of banning AI use, Swiftcruit scores how candidates use it — prompt quality, validation behavior, iteration depth, over-reliance signals. That produces a scorecard with separate dimensions for technical correctness, process, AI collaboration, and integrity. The ceiling appears when your hiring process requires deep ATS integration or custom workflow hooks — the vendor page describes no API and no self-hosted option, so what you see is what you get.
Bottom line: Pick this when your core frustration is hiring developers who look sharp in a take-home but cannot actually drive AI tools on the job; skip it when your stack requires API-level integration or your compliance team needs the platform behind your own firewall.

Pros
Sign in to edit- Generates tailored assessments directly from a job description — including coded problems with hidden test cases — so recruiters without engineering backgrounds can stand up a technically credible screen without writing a single question.
- AI usage scoring captures prompt quality, validation behavior, and iteration depth as separate signals, which means you can distinguish a candidate who uses AI as a crutch from one who uses it as a force multiplier — a distinction a standard take-home cannot make.
- Candidates work in an AI-enabled environment that mirrors actual development conditions, so you avoid eliminating strong engineers who would have performed well on the actual job but blanked on an artificial no-AI constraint.
- A sample scorecard and a no-account question generator are available before any commitment, so you can run the real pipeline against your actual job description and inspect output quality before signing up.
- Instant scorecards with rubric-graded per-question breakdowns reduce the manual review queue, so a single recruiter can process a volume of submissions that would otherwise require engineering time to evaluate.
Cons
Sign in to edit- No API is documented on the vendor page, which means scorecard data cannot be pulled programmatically into an ATS or downstream analytics tool — teams hiring at high volume will hit a manual-export bottleneck as soon as they want structured data in their system of record.
- No self-hosted option exists, so organizations with data residency requirements or security policies that prohibit candidate data leaving a controlled environment cannot use the platform — those teams evaluate alternatives with on-premise deployment support.
- The integrity score and AI usage signals depend entirely on the instrumented environment Swiftcruit controls; a candidate completing an assessment on a second device or outside the browser environment produces no meaningful signal, and the platform has no described mechanism to detect or prevent this at scale.
- Assessment customization beyond what the JD-to-assessment pipeline produces is not described in detail on the vendor page — teams with proprietary internal rubrics or domain-specific evaluation criteria that deviate from standard role templates will find the degree of manual override unclear before committing.

Swiftcruit converts a pasted job description into a structured technical assessment — multiple-choice, descriptive with rubric, and coding problems tested against hidden test cases — without requiring any account to generate a first draft. Candidates complete the assessment in an environment where AI use is permitted and instrumented. The recruiter receives a scorecard broken into technical score, process score, AI usage score, and an integrity score, all generated without manual grading.
The distinguishing design choice is what the vendor calls ‘AI usage scoring.’ Rather than treating AI assistance as cheating, the platform tracks how a candidate prompts, validates output, debugs, and iterates — then surfaces that as a structured signal alongside final solution quality. The framing is explicit on the vendor page: the meaningful question is not whether a candidate used AI, but how well they used it. That signal does not exist in a standard coding screen.
Swiftcruit fits teams hiring for technical roles where AI-assisted workflows are already part of the job, and where recruiters lack the bandwidth to manually review coding submissions at volume. The vendor page describes estimated savings of roughly $19 per candidate at scale. Where it breaks: there is no API, no self-hosted deployment option, and no described integration layer with ATS platforms. Teams that need to pull scorecard data into an existing system — Greenhouse, Lever, Workday — will find no documented path to do that without manual export.
